BfKit Swift is a powerful Swift library that provides a collection of useful tools and extensions for iOS development. This comprehensive library aims to make your coding experience more efficient and productive by offering a wide range of functionalities.
- Convenient collection of Swift extensions
- Enhanced networking capabilities
- Intuitive user interface components
- Efficient debugging tools
- Useful utility functions for common tasks
